DevOps methodologies center around a few core principles. First, there's the emphasis on continuous integration and continuous delivery (CI/CD), which involves simplifying the process of building, testing, and deploying software changes habitually. This allows for quicker feedback loops and reduces the risk of introducing problems into production. Second, DevOps promotes a culture of collaboration between developers and operations teams, breaking down silos and fostering dialogue. This shared responsibility ensures that everyone is working towards the same goals.

  • Additionally, DevOps relies heavily on monitoring and feedback mechanisms to identify areas for improvement. By gathering data on application performance and user behavior, teams can actively address issues and optimize the software development process.

Boosting Software Delivery: The Power of DevOps Pipelines

In today's fast-paced IT landscape, corporations are constantly seeking ways to launch high-quality software quickly. DevOps pipelines have emerged as a powerful solution to this challenge. By facilitating the software development and delivery processes, DevOps pipelines enable squads to reduce lead times, optimize software quality, and increase overall productivity.

A robust DevOps pipeline typically comprises a series of steps, each aimed at specific responsibilities. These stages may include version control, build, test, deployment, and monitoring. Continuous integration (CI) and continuous delivery (CD) are key principles that drive the efficiency of DevOps check here pipelines. CI involves repeatedly merging code changes into a shared repository, while CD facilitates the deployment of code changes to production environments.
